What the Economics Teachers, Postsecondary median says in Syracuse, NY
The May 2025 BLS OEWS estimate puts the Economics Teachers, Postsecondary median in Syracuse, NY at $123,940 per year. Median means the middle of the published wage spread. It is not one worker's pay. It is not a job offer. The row is tied to SOC 25-1063 and BLS area 45060.
BLS lists Not published wage and salary jobs for this exact role-place row. That is a survey estimate. It is not a count of open posts. The local mean is $125,380 per year. Mean uses all wage values behind the estimate, so high or low values can move it away from the median.
Syracuse, NY's Economics Teachers, Postsecondary median and the U.S. Economics Teachers, Postsecondary median of $123,920 have the same published median after rounding. The comparison uses the same SOC code and source period. It does not add price levels, taxes, benefits, hours, or a person's work history.

Pay range
Read the Syracuse, NY wage ladder for Economics Teachers, Postsecondary
The 10th percentile is $63,190 per year. The 25th percentile is $82,070 per year. The median is $123,940 per year. The 75th percentile is $162,550 per year. The 90th percentile is $220,890 per year.
A percentile is a rank point, not a career stage. The 10th percentile does not mean new-worker pay. The 90th percentile does not mean a wage that comes after a set number of years. The points show how the wage values spread in the source. They do not say why one job sits at one point.
The middle half runs from $82,070 per year to $162,550 per year. The 10th-to-90th span is $157,700. Use the full ladder when a job post sits far from the median.

How common Economics Teachers, Postsecondary is in Syracuse, NY
BLS lists Not published Economics Teachers, Postsecondary jobs in Syracuse, NY. It also lists Not published jobs per 1,000 local jobs. Jobs per 1,000 turns the count into a rate. It helps compare places of different size. It does not show open posts or hiring speed.
The location quotient is Not published. A value of 1 means Economics Teachers, Postsecondary has the same share of local jobs as it has across the nation. This row is not available for a share check. The quotient is a share check, not a wage or a growth measure.
Read the three values as separate facts. Employment asks how many covered jobs BLS estimated. Jobs per 1,000 asks how much of the local job base the role takes. Location quotient asks how that share compares with the national share. None of them tells you how many posts are open today.

Price-level view
What $123,940 may mean after the Syracuse, NY price level
BEA's 2024 all-items price index for Syracuse, NY is 95.7. The U.S. level is 100. The local level is 4.3% below that mark. This is a broad price comparison. It is not a personal budget.
WageScope divides the $123,940 Economics Teachers, Postsecondary median by 95.7 divided by 100. The result is $129,452 in national-price dollars per year. This proxy keeps the math clear. It is not take-home pay and does not set a move target.
Housing is 80.7. Goods are 99.7. Utilities are 133.4. Other services are 97.8. The parts do not move as one. WageScope uses BEA's all-items index for the proxy and does not make its own basket.
The employment RSE for this Economics Teachers, Postsecondary row is Not published. The mean-wage RSE is 1.7%. RSE means relative standard error. It is a survey precision flag. A smaller value often means less sampling uncertainty. It is not the chance that one person's pay is right or wrong.
The employment RSE belongs to the Not published job estimate. The mean-wage RSE belongs to the $125,380 mean. BLS does not give the same RSE field for the median or every percentile. WageScope does not move an RSE from one field to another.
A local row can change in a new release. A small role-place sample can also have more survey uncertainty than a broad national row. Keep the May 2025 date next to the value. Do not mix a newer job post with the BLS date as if both facts came from one clock.
